Remove the doll house from the package and remove the tape from the door. Grab your black spray paint and head outside! Now that you are outside or in a well ventilated area, open the little door just a little and spray the entire house with a nice even light coat. Let the spray paint dry. Turn dollar store mason jars into eerie lanterns. Use black paint to draw spooky faces or scenes on the jars. Once the paint is dry, place a battery-operated candle inside each jar. ... Discover how to transform a ... gordon ramsay kicks rapinoe out Shape the candles in several small steps, adding more hot water each time. Soak, then shape the candle gently. Add more hot water, soak, and shape a little bit more. Repeat these steps until the candles have the desired bends and curves. Share. ... “In-Store Pickup” and “UPS Delivery” Displayed: this item can be shipped for FREE to your local Dollar Tree store, or you can choose to have this item shipped via UPS directly to you (shipping fees apply). aarp pool games Ok, so some of us are absolutely terrified of spiders, but for those who aren’t, decorating with them is great for Halloween. You can pick up a large bag of plastic spider rings at most Dollar Stores or Dollar Tree Stores for around $1.
